Sanders urges OpenAI, Anthropic, Meta to pause AI development amid regulatory push

Senator Bernie Sanders is calling on major AI developers like OpenAI, Anthropic, and Meta to pause their work. He suggests legislative action could follow if companies don't voluntarily slow down their rapid advancements in artificial intelligence.
